Ingredients

List of Key Ingredients

– 1 can (15 oz) black beans, rinsed and drained

– 1 can (15 oz) sweet corn, drained

– 1 red bell pepper, diced into small cubes

– 1 green bell pepper, diced into small cubes

– 1 small red onion, finely chopped

– 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ved

– 1 ripe avocado, diced into bite-sized pieces

– 1/4 cup fresh cilantro, finely chopped

– 2 tablespoons fresh lime juice

– 1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il

– 1 teaspoon ground cumin

– 1 teaspoon chili powder

–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ste

These ingredients combine to create a fresh and vibrant Southwest Black Bean Salad. Each component adds flavor, texture, and nutrition to the dish. The black beans provide protein and fiber, while the sweet corn adds a pop of sweetness. The bell peppers and cherry tomatoes bring a crisp bite, and the avocado offers creamy richness.

Ingredient Substitutions

Alternative beans: You can use pinto beans or kidney beans if you prefer. Both add unique flavors.

Fresh vs canned: Fresh ingredients are great, but canned beans and corn save time. Just rinse and drain.

Lime juice substitutes: If you don’t have lime juice, lemon juice works well. It adds a similar tangy flavor.

Nutritional Information

Caloric content: This salad is around 200 calories per serving, making it a healthy choice.

Macronutrient breakdown: Each serving has about 9g of protein, 8g of fat, and 30g of carbs.

Health benefits of key ingredients: Black beans are high in fiber, which helps digestion. Avocado provides healthy fats. Bell peppers are full of vitamins A and C.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paration of Ingredients

1. Start by rinsing and draining the black beans. This helps remove extra salt and makes them taste fresh.

2. Next, drain the sweet corn. This adds a nice sweetness to the salad.

3. Now, chop the red and green bell peppers into small cubes. They add crunch and color.

4. Finely chop the red onion. This gives a nice sharp flavor.

5. Halve the cherry tomatoes. Their juiciness brightens up the dish.

6. Finally, dice the avocado into bite-sized pieces. This brings creaminess to the salad.

Mixing the Salad

1. In a large bowl, combine the black beans and sweet corn. This will be the hearty base for your salad.

2. Add the diced red and green bell peppers, chopped onion, and halved cherry tomatoes. Stir gently to mix.

3. Carefully fold in the diced avocado and chopped cilantro. Be gentle to keep the avocado intact.

4. In a small bowl, whisk together the lime juice, olive oil, cumin, chili powder, salt, and pepper. This dressing packs a lot of flavor.

5. Drizzle the dressing over the salad mixture and toss gently. Make sure everything gets coated.

Final Touches

1. Taste your salad. Adjust the seasoning if needed. Add more salt, pepper, or lime juice to your liking.

2. For the best flavor, chill the salad in the fridge for at least 30 minutes. This lets the flavors blend well.

Tips & Tricks

Enhancing Flavor

To boost the flavor, marinate the salad for at least 30 minutes. This helps the taste blend well. You can add more spices like smoked paprika or cayenne pepper for extra heat. These spices bring a smoky profile that pairs nicely with the beans.

Texture Tips

To keep avocado from becoming mushy, add it last. Fold it in gently. Use fresh veggies like bell peppers, corn, and onions for a nice crunch. Toasted nuts or seeds can also add a delightful texture contrast.

Serving Suggestions

Pair the salad with grilled chicken or fish for a complete meal. You can also serve it in taco shells for a fun twist. Try using it as a topping for nachos or a filling for burritos. Serve it chilled for a refreshing dish on hot days.

Variations

Ingredient Swaps

You can make this Southwest Black Bean Salad your own. One easy way is to swap beans. Use pinto, kidney, or chickpeas. Each option adds a unique taste.

You can also add proteins. If you want chicken, grill or sauté it first. For a plant-based option, try cubed tofu. Both add heartiness to your salad.

Dressing Variations

The dressing is key to flavor. You can spice it up by adding jalapeños or hot sauce. This gives a nice kick to the dish.

For a creamy twist, mix in some Greek yogurt or sour cream. This adds richness and balances the other flavors.

Seasonal Adaptations

Change your salad with the seasons. In winter, add roasted sweet potatoes or butternut squash. These ingredients provide warmth and comfort.

In summer, go for fresh herbs like basil or mint. You can also toss in seasonal fruits like mango or peaches for a refreshing twist.

Storage Info

Storing Leftovers

Store your Southwest Black Bean Salad in an airtight container. This keeps it fresh longer. Use glass or BPA-free plastic containers for best results. In the fridge, it lasts about 3 to 5 days.

Freezing Options

Yes, you can freeze the salad, but it may change texture. If freezing, use a freezer-safe container. To thaw, place it in the fridge overnight. This helps keep the salad from becoming mushy.

Reviving Leftovers

To re-serve, take the salad out of the fridge. Give it a gentle stir and check the flavors. If it needs a boost, add more lime juice or salt. This will revive its bright taste. Enjoy the salad fresh for the best experience.

FAQs

Common Ingredients Questions

Can I omit certain ingredients?

Yes, you can. This salad is very flexible. If you dislike an ingredient, simply leave it out. For example, skip the red onion if you prefer less bite. You can also add other veggies like cucumbers or jalapeños for a twist.

What if I don’t have lime juice?

If you lack lime juice, use lemon juice instead. It gives a similar tang. You can also try vinegar, like apple cider vinegar. Just remember to use a smaller amount, as vinegar can be stronger.

Frequently Asked Recipe Questions

How to make it vegan?

This salad is already vegan! All ingredients are plant-based. You can enjoy it without worrying about animal products. It’s packed with flavors and nutrients.

How long does it take to prepare?

The prep time is about 15 minutes. If you chill it, total time is 45 minutes. This allows the flavors to blend nicely. You’ll have a tasty salad ready in no time.

Nutritional Questions

Is it gluten-free?

Yes, this salad is gluten-free. It uses beans and veggies, which do not contain gluten. It’s a great choice for those with gluten sensitivities.

What are the health benefits of black beans?

Black beans are very nutritious. They are high in protein and fiber. This helps keep you full. They also contain antioxidants and support heart health. Eating black beans can help stabilize blood sugar too.
